The last week of November has arrived (this month flew by) and it’s going to be a fairly wet week in Brampton, according to Environment Canada. Today we will see a high of five degrees with rain.
Tomorrow the Brampton temperature will drop slightly to two degrees with a chance of flurries or flurries. Wednesday, Nov. 28, the temperature will stay at two degrees and there will be a 30 percent chance of flurries.
By Thursday the Brampton temperature will rise slightly to four degrees and it will be cloudy.
Friday, leading into the weekend, we will see a high of three degrees and a 30 percent chance of flurries with some sun and clouds.
On the first day of December the Brampton temperature will be about two degrees and sadly Friday’s sun will disappear and it will be cloudy again.
Sunday, Dec. 2, we will see a high of four degrees and a 60 percent chance of showers.
